Ticket: Config vault for Pellworth hot-reload is locked after three failed unseal attempts. Hot-reloading is paused; services are running on last-known-good config. New folks: do not restart the reload daemon — it drops the cache. Unseal first, then trigger a manual sync. Use the recovery passphrase provided on the next line to unseal the vault.

unlock words, bahop-fawef: novmir-druwyn-soriel-rusdor-kasion

Meeting notes — Brightmoor admin dashboard, dark-mode rollout.

Dark mode ships to all admin users next Thursday behind a per-user toggle in Display Settings; default stays light. Known issues: chart legends render low-contrast in the Ordersview panel (fix in progress) and exported PDFs always use light styling, which is intentional. Support team: if users report unreadable text, first ask them to clear cached themes, then log it under the dark-mode tag. Escalations for anything beyond that go to the rollout owner named below.

approver of fahap-tahag = Silir Ralax Ralvan

# TaxGlance Environments

TaxGlance caches tax-rate lookups per region. Cache TTL is short in staging, long in prod. If a customer reports stale rates, check the cache age metric before escalating — nine times out of ten it's a pending refresh, not a bug. Flushes are self-service via the ops panel; no engineering ticket needed. Staging resets nightly. Prod config below is the source of truth for support queries.

config for bawig-fadup:
[zorix]
host = zorix.lumicworks.corp
user = zorix_svc
database = zorix_prod

Welcome to the Murkfen telemetry team. Device payloads are compressed with our in-house Brindle codec before upload; the gateway rejects anything uncompressed over 4 KB. Build the codec locally with `make brindle`, run the round-trip tests, and compare ratios against the fixtures in the corpus directory. When you're ready to push a gateway build, the artifact has to be signed, and you'll sign with the key shown here.

rollout seal: bky19_M1Zvn1YQwEBTy4XxP3H